Output bbf8faa4eb420d6c92346d6a76abc88988cda173a65a4ac804801d8bd503b19f:66

value
744350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a3ef16f3a28d9f3a9ac53589a825f39f3bd6c54 OP_EQUAL
address
38TbL6uk6YRt8TafEVLV1EpryBA3eBYU2F
transaction
bbf8faa4eb420d6c92346d6a76abc88988cda173a65a4ac804801d8bd503b19f
confirmations
242805
spent
true